The Nampa Police Department says a mountain lion was spotted about 8:15 this morning near the Centennial Golf Course in Nampa, at 11th Ave. North and Ridgecrest Drive

According to the Police Sergeant Tim Randall, “A man was walking his dog along the canal (near the Golf Course) and came face-to-face with the mountain lion as it was following him.”

The man was not uninjured, according to police. The mountain lion then apparently ran off.

Police say the Golf Course has also spotted what appears to be mountain lion paw tracks in the sandy areas along the course.

Nampa Police and Fish and Game officers are on the scene.

There have been a number of reported sightings of the mountain over the past few weeks, mainly in Ada County, along the Boise River.
